Take the MTS Bus (routes 258 or 671) directly into downtown San Diego—about 25 minutes with frequent service. For more comfort, Uber or Lyft are widely available, with trips taking 15–20 minutes. Alternatively, Hillcrest is near the I-5 freeway entrance, allowing a quick 10-minute drive to downtown. Some local hotels also offer shuttle services, enhancing convenience for travelers seeking flexibility and comfort.

Take SDMTD Bus Route 902 from Hillcrest—about a 25-minute ride with frequent departures and scenic views. Alternatively, drive via the I-5 Freeway northbound to the Balboa Park Exit, then turn onto Park Blvd. The journey takes only 15 minutes. Arrive early to avoid traffic and allow ample time to explore key exhibits like the Giant Panda Pavilion and African Savanna.

I'm giving this place a solid 5-star review! The hostel is clean, welcoming, and perfectly located for exploring downtown San Diego—super easy to get around by public transit. That said, I do need to mention something that concerned me during check-in: the front desk staff asked for my credit card, wrote down all the information by hand, and even removed the CVV protection sticker on the back of the card. It felt really risky and made me uneasy about potential fraud or misuse. While everything turned out fine, I’d strongly recommend the team reconsider this practice for guest safety and peace of mind.
